They remain the dominant force in Scottish football as Brendan Rodgers' side make it 12 titles in 13 seasons.

It was sealed with a 5-0 romp away to Kilmarnock but, in truth, there were multiple signs Celtic's vice-like grip on the Scottish Premiership trophy would remain unbreakable WEEKS before their crowning evening in Ayrshire.

Winning is all that matters, of course, but Celtic produced a performance of pure verve and swagger to seal it at a venue they have now earned their crowning moment at four times in the 21st century. Adam Idah, take a bow, as the Norwich loanee wowed from kick-off. His predatory instincts were on show for the opener as he turned home Matt O'Riley's perfect cross. But a bloodied Robbie Deas believed the Irishman believed he was roughed up before the opener.

A good Idah Jamie Carragher revealed on Wednesday he craves to do a deep-dive analysis more often than just his Monday Night Football segment and Idah's tigerish display at Rugby Park would make the perfect subject. Hart Attack The keeper who wears his heart on his sleeve caused a throng of Celtic fans to look downbeat and dejected as he writhed about the Rugby Park surface before limping on one leg. The revered 38-year-old – the finest English keeper of his era – managed to shake off his complaint but his momentary plight underlined the peril of the beautiful game and the importance of Hart.
